Limits of accuracy — practice question

(a)[1]

A car is moving at $84\text{ km/h}$. Calculate how many metres the car covers in one minute.

(b)[1]

A runner finishes a race in $12.3$ seconds, accurate to the nearest tenth of a second. What is the lower bound for the runner’s time?
